
Unlocking Bitcoin: Stacks and Its Innovative Use Cases - Stacks (STX) March 25 2025
Share
An Overview of Stacks (STX): Exploring Its Use Cases
Stacks (STX) is a unique blockchain project designed to enable smart contracts and decentralized applications (DApps) on Bitcoin. By building on top of the Bitcoin blockchain, Stacks combines the security and stability of Bitcoin with the flexibility and functionality of modern smart contracts. This combination results in a variety of attractive use cases for developers and users alike.
Building Smart Contracts on Bitcoin
Stacks offers a unique proposition by allowing developers to create smart contracts directly on the Bitcoin network. This is achieved through the "Clarity" programming language, developed specifically for Stacks. Clarity is a decidable language, meaning that its code is predictable and reliable, a feature that reduces unexpected bugs and errors. This offers significant advantages for developers aiming to build secure and reliable smart contracts using Bitcoin's robust foundational system.
Decentralized Applications (DApps)
Through its support for smart contracts, Stacks enables a wide range of decentralized applications that leverage the secure layer of Bitcoin. This is significant for projects that prioritize security and want to utilize Bitcoin's blockchain as a safe bedrock for decentralized operations. DApps can range from decentralized finance (DeFi) projects and voting systems to games and entertainment platforms.
Decentralized Finance (DeFi)
Stacks provides an opportunity for developers to bring DeFi to Bitcoin. With DeFi protocols running on Stacks, users can engage in activities such as lending, borrowing, and earning yield all while relying on Bitcoin’s well-established security. This expands the DeFi universe to include the vast Bitcoin network, which can attract more traditional Bitcoin holders to the DeFi space.
Decentralized Identity and Privacy
One of Stacks' core uses is in facilitating decentralized identity systems. By leveraging its unique properties and Clarity language, Stacks can support robust, privacy-focused identity solutions that offer users control over their personal data. The decentralized nature of this service provides enhanced privacy and security, allowing users to prove their identity or manage credentials without relying on centralized authorities.
Tokenized Assets and NFTs
Another prominent use case for Stacks is the support of tokenized assets, including non-fungible tokens (NFTs). Artists and creators can mint and manage NFTs on a secure platform that benefits from Bitcoin's strong network. This provides a compelling use case for digital ownership and the tokenization of physical and digital assets, enabling a secure and scalable marketplace for NFTs.
Thus, Stacks positions itself uniquely within the blockchain ecosystem, bridging Bitcoin's security with the rich functionality offered by smart contracts and DApps. While Stacks' pathway involves some challenges, particularly in educating and attracting developers from other platforms, its potential applications continue to draw interest in the expanding crypto landscape.